Einhell Germany AG designs, manufactures, and distributes power tools, garden equipment, and workshop accessories for DIY enthusiasts, semi-professional users, and tradespeople. The company operates through two primary segments: Tools (power tools, cordless tools, and accessories) and Garden & Leisure (lawn mowers, trimmers, chainsaws, pressure washers, and other outdoor equipment).
The Power X-Change battery platform is the centerpiece of Einhell's product strategy. The system uses interchangeable lithium-ion batteries across more than 300 devices, providing consumers with a cost-effective and convenient cordless tool ecosystem. Einhell's products are positioned in the value-to-mid-range price segment, targeting consumers who want reliable cordless tools without the premium pricing of professional-grade brands.
Einhell products are sold in over 90 countries through major DIY retailers, home improvement stores, online marketplaces, and specialist tool shops. The company maintains a global distribution network supported by subsidiaries and sales offices across Europe, Asia, South America, and Africa.
